How to Use Virtual Certifications to Build a Personal Brand Online

In today’s digital world, standing out is more important than ever. Whether you're a freelancer, entrepreneur, or job seeker, building a personal brand can open new doors. One of the best ways to establish credibility and gain trust is through virtual certifications. These online credentials not only enhance your skills but also help you showcase your expertise in a competitive market.


Why Virtual Certifications Matter for Personal Branding


1. Boost Your Credibility

Certifications from well-known institutions instantly add authority to your profile, making potential clients and employers more likely to trust your expertise.

2. Showcase Your Commitment to Growth

By earning certifications, you demonstrate a commitment to continuous learning, which is essential for career success.

3. Stand Out in Your Industry

A personal brand with recognized certifications sets you apart from others in your field, helping you attract better opportunities.

4. Increase Online Visibility

Certifications give you more content to share on LinkedIn, social media, and personal websites, improving your online presence.


Steps to Use Virtual Certifications for Personal Branding


1. Choose Certifications That Align with Your Niche

Not all certifications are equally beneficial. Select ones that align with your industry and personal brand goals.

  • Digital marketers can opt for Google Analytics, HubSpot, or Facebook Blueprint certifications.

  • Freelancers can benefit from SEO, content writing, or social media management courses.

  • Tech professionals may choose AWS, Microsoft Azure, or web development certifications.


2. Display Certifications on Your Online Profiles

Once you earn a certification, make sure to add it to your:

  • LinkedIn profile (under the "Licenses & Certifications" section)

  • Personal website or portfolio

  • Freelance profiles on platforms like Upwork and Fiverr

  • Social media bio (if relevant to your audience)


3. Create Content Around Your Certifications

To establish authority, use your new knowledge to create valuable content:

  • Write blog posts summarizing key takeaways from your courses.

  • Share LinkedIn posts discussing industry insights.

  • Create YouTube videos or Instagram reels explaining complex topics.


4. Network and Engage with Industry Professionals

  • Join online communities and forums related to your certifications.

  • Connect with fellow professionals on LinkedIn and discuss trends.

  • Participate in webinars, Q&A sessions, and online summits.


5. Leverage Certifications to Offer Services

Once you’ve gained knowledge, turn it into an income source:

  • Offer freelance services in your field.

  • Start consulting or coaching sessions based on your expertise.

  • Launch an online course or eBook to share your insights.
